Insignia NS-RTM14WH5-C Refrigerator Manual

The Insignia NS-RTM14WH5-C is a 14 cu. ft. top-freezer refrigerator designed for efficient cooling and storage. It features adjustable shelves, a crisper drawer for fruits and vegetables, and a reversible door for flexible installation. Installation

Unpack and inspect contents. Place on a level surface away from heat sources.

  1. Remove all packaging materials.
  2. Position the refrigerator in a well-ventilated area.
  3. Ensure the door opens freely without obstruction.
  4. Plug into a grounded outlet.

WARNING! Ensure the refrigerator is stable to avoid tipping.

First-Time Setup

Power on the refrigerator and allow it to cool for several hours before use.

  1. Set the temperature controls to the recommended settings.
  2. Allow the refrigerator to reach the desired temperature before adding food.
  3. Organize items for optimal airflow.

CAUTION! Do not overload the refrigerator to ensure proper cooling.

Connecting Power

Ensure the refrigerator is plugged into a dedicated outlet with proper voltage.

  1. Use a grounded outlet to prevent electrical hazards.
  2. Avoid using extension cords.
  3. Check for any signs of damage to the power cord.

Tip: Regularly check the power connection for safety.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Refrigerator not coolingPower supply issueCheck outlet and power cord.
Noise from refrigeratorImproper levelingAdjust feet to level the refrigerator.
Frost buildupDoor seal issueInspect and replace door seals if necessary.
Water pooling insideClogged defrost drainClear the drain to restore proper drainage.

Reset: Unplug for 5 minutes to reset the system.
